Output dd26ea80551a9564415003ae7beba87ec8b1a935c410f2c43e6cee209059837a:14

value
176383
script pubkey
OP_0 OP_PUSHBYTES_32 bfa7204fe92fdefbc74e34f75bbf23222633d77a6c41c7ab7a94e7805b8513eb
address
bc1qh7njqnlf9l00h36wxnm4h0erygnr84m6d3qu02m6jnncqku9z04svqcqpn
transaction
dd26ea80551a9564415003ae7beba87ec8b1a935c410f2c43e6cee209059837a